Henry Schein, Inc. to Join the NASDAQ-100 Index Beginning October 2, 2007


NEW YORK, Oct. 1, 2007 (PRIME NEWSWIRE) -- Henry Schein, Inc. (Nasdaq:HSIC) of Melville, New York, will become a component of the NASDAQ-100 Index(r) (Nasdaq:NDX) and the NASDAQ-100 Equal Weighted Index (Nasdaq:NDXE) prior to market open on Tuesday, October 2, 2007. Henry Schein, Inc. will replace Maxim Integrated Products, Inc. (Nasdaq:MXIM).

With a market capitalization of approximately $5.4 billion, Henry Schein, Inc. distributes healthcare products and services, including practice management software, to office-based healthcare practitioner. The company's operations include direct marketing, telesales and field sales.

The NASDAQ-100 Index, launched in January 1985, is one of the most widely followed benchmarks in the world.

NASDAQ is the largest U.S. equities exchange. With approximately 3,100 companies, it lists more companies and, on average, trades more shares per day than any other U.S. market. It is home to companies that are leaders across all areas of business including technology, retail, communications, financial services, transportation, media and biotechnology. NASDAQ is the primary market for trading NASDAQ-listed stocks as well as a leading liquidity pool for trading NYSE-listed stocks.
